The -daemonize option is too restrictive when using with SDL. It also switches the working directory to / too early which causes block devices with a relative path to fail.
The -daemonize option is needed for my regression testing so I've included this patch in the series. This patch hasn't changed since v1. Index: qemu/vl.c =================================================================== --- qemu.orig/vl.c 2008-02-01 11:53:42.000000000 -0600 +++ qemu/vl.c 2008-02-01 11:53:44.000000000 -0600 @@ -8779,11 +8779,6 @@ } #ifndef _WIN32 - if (daemonize && !nographic && vnc_display == NULL) { - fprintf(stderr, "Can only daemonize if using -nographic or -vnc\n"); - daemonize = 0; - } - if (daemonize) { pid_t pid; @@ -8821,7 +8816,6 @@ exit(1); umask(027); - chdir("/"); signal(SIGTSTP, SIG_IGN); signal(SIGTTOU, SIG_IGN); @@ -9087,6 +9081,7 @@ if (len != 1) exit(1); + chdir("/"); TFR(fd = open("/dev/null", O_RDWR)); if (fd == -1) exit(1);
